Policy 5.17 Official College Sponsored Social Media
It is the policy of the Board of Trustees of Richland Community College to acknowledge that social media plays a

n important role in the lives of the community, students, faculty, and staff. Richland Community College will maintain official social media sites to support the College in accomplishing its mission and vision, achieving its goals and objectives, and advancing the College’s Core Values. The President or designees shall be responsible for disseminating public information about the College through the use of official College sponsored social media. Richland Community College encourages feedback and comments from our followers, which include prospective students, current students, alumni, staff and members of the community. We remain committed to maintaining these sites as a safe and family-friendly forum for sharing information. In the spirit of maintaining a positive environment to our site visitors, Richland Community College reserves the right to remove any comments or wall postings from official college-sponsored pages that are inappropriate, inflammatory or damaging to Richland Community College or any individual. The sixth annual Operation Obstacle is coming up quickly! Register now for the 2-mile, 25-obstacle race on September 19.

The event will be held at the Workforce Development Institute building on Richland's main campus. Check-in & same day registration run from 8:30 – 9:30 AM. The Welcome ceremony starts at 10 AM, and the race begins at 10:15 AM.

This race was created to raise awareness of veteran su***de and is held in coordination with the U.S. Department of Veteran’s Affairs Su***de Prevention Team and Richland Community College. After completing 20-25 fun physical obstacles, each finisher will receive an honorary challenge medal, goodie bags, snacks and water. Special awards will be given to the top three male and female finishers.

Anyone interested in simply going through obstacles without the pressure to compete can register for the non-competitive fun run.

Interested in joining our Board of Trustees? Nominating petitions for people seeking election to the Board are now available by appointment or electronically.

The positions on the Board of Trustees which will appear on the ballot in this election are two full six-year terms for seats currently held by Maryann Albers and Vicki Carr. The nominating papers may be filed with the Secretary of the Board of Trustees from Tuesday, November 16, 2026, through Monday, November 23, 2026, electronically or by appointment.

The election will be conducted Tuesday, April 6, 2027.
